Spark plug dimensions encompass a variety of aspects including thread size, reach, seat type, and the heat range. The thread size is integral as it must match the engine's cylinder head thread to ensure a proper fit. Common thread sizes include 10 mm, 12 mm, 14 mm, and 18 mm. Each size is designed with specific engine types and sizes in mind. A mismatch can lead to blowouts or misfiring, which quickly degrades engine performance and reliability. The reach of a spark plug refers to the length of the threaded section that screws into the engine. It is essential to ensure correct protrusion into the combustion chamber without interfering with moving components. An incorrect reach can cause damage; for example, a plug that is too short will not adequately ignite the fuel-air mixture, while one that is too long may result in damage from piston strikes.

Another critical dimension is the seat type, which generally includes two types flat and tapered. The sealing capability between the spark plug and the cylinder head is contingent on choosing the correct seat type. A poor seal can cause compression leaks, reducing engine efficiency and potentially leading to costly repairs. Heat range, though not a physical dimension, is interconnected with the spark plug's performance. It refers to how quickly the spark plug can transfer heat from the combustion chamber. This attribute needs to be optimized with the specific engine requirements; a plug with an inappropriate heat range can lead to fouling or pre-ignition.
